Push lock for door thickness 16mm | GSV-No. 7740

Description

The push lock GSV-No. 7740 is a precision-engineered locking device designed for secure closure of doors, panels, and lightweight furniture elements with a door thickness of 16 mm. It is a versatile solution for residential, commercial, and industrial applications, providing reliable functionality in a compact and durable form factor. The lock case is manufactured from high-quality plastic, offering excellent dimensional stability, resistance to impact, and reduced wear under frequent operation.

This push lock is available in two versions for the operating components—knob and ring—either made from plastic or stainless steel. The plastic variant provides a lightweight, cost-effective option with smooth operation and low friction, while the stainless steel version ensures higher mechanical strength, long-term durability, and resistance to corrosion, making it ideal for environments with higher usage or exposure to moisture.

The lock functions through an integrated spring mechanism that enables effortless opening and secure closure. Pressing the knob or ring releases the locking catch, allowing the door or panel to be opened. Once released, the mechanism automatically re-engages, ensuring a reliable and consistent locking position. This self-actuating feature minimizes the risk of accidental opening and ensures the door remains securely closed.

Installation is straightforward due to the compact design, which allows easy integration into furniture and panel assemblies without complex modifications. The GSV-No. 7740 push lock combines durable materials, reliable mechanical performance, and flexible application options, making it a technically advanced solution for secure, user-friendly door closure in both domestic and professional settings.
